his is the sixth year that Decennial Mineral Exploration Conferences (DMEC) has served as the patron for Exploration Trends & Developments. DMEC organized the very successful Exploration ‘17 conference, held in Toronto in 2017, the sixth in the series of conferences which began in 1967. This year DMEC support came from the sponsoring companies listed on pages 14 and 15. The ETD review originated with the Geological Survey of Canada (GSC), where for more than 50 years GSC scientists prepared an unbiased annual publication on trends and new developments in geophysical exploration for minerals. This marks the 30th year that Patrick Killeen has written the review, originally as a GSC research scientist. The Canadian Exploration Geophysical Society (KEGS) was the patron of ETD between 2007 and 2016. DMEC and KEGS are committed to the promotion of geophysics, especially as it is applied to the exploration for minerals other than oil; to fostering the scientific interests of geophysicists; and to promoting high professional standards, fellowship and co-operation among persons interested in this industry.
